It's super duper complicated. You have a code in the box which you use on a
web site. This code will give you a code to enter into the redeem code
section of your console. That code will download a key. You then launch the
game, and select Rock Band Store. When selected, a Lego Rock Band Export
Pack option will be available. This does not show without the first key. You
select that, and then pay your ten dollars. You will then download all Lego
Rock Band songs to your harddrive. yee haw!
